Sir Sydney Turing Barlow Lawford (born November 16, 1865 in Tunbridge Wells , † February 15, 1953 in California ) was a British officer.

During the First World War he was commander of the 41st Division of the New Army and was knighted for his services on January 1, 1918 as Knight Commander of the Order of the Bath (KCB).

Lawford was last lieutenant general in the British Army.

Lawford was the father of actor Peter Lawford .
